Dayforce is a cloud-based human capital management (HCM) platform offered by Ceridian that centralizes payroll, HR, workforce management, time and attendance, benefits, and talent management in a single application. Delivered as a SaaS solution, Dayforce targets mid-market and enterprise customers to streamline workforce processes, compliance, and payroll operations.
β’ Administer payroll operations by processing payroll accurately and timely, ensuring compliance with established schedules, organizational policies, and applicable government regulations. β’ Manage employee payroll transactions by processing new hires, terminations, pay rate changes, and other payroll updates while maintaining data accuracy and integrity. β’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local payroll, tax, wage, and hour regulations by monitoring requirements, applying best practices, and maintaining accurate payroll records. β’ Prepare and submit state tax filings and quarterly tax reports while maintaining tax records and ensuring timely reporting and payment obligations are met. β’ Maintain and reconcile payroll records, reports, and supporting documentation to ensure accurate payroll reporting, audit readiness, and record retention compliance. β’ Support internal and external audits by compiling, reviewing, and providing payroll records, reports, and required documentation to auditors and regulatory agencies. β’ Develop, compile, and analyze payroll- and HR-related reports, summaries, and data logs to support decision-making and respond to requests from senior leadership and Human Resources. β’ Provide payroll-related technical support, troubleshooting, and guidance to employees, managers, and HR team members to resolve issues and improve understanding of payroll processes. β’ Monitor payroll technology, data management, and security practices by maintaining current knowledge of industry trends, system enhancements, and regulatory developments to support continuous process improvement. β’ Collaborate with Human Resources team members on daily departmental operations and special projects, performing additional duties as assigned to support organizational objectives. β’ Mentor and provide guidance to Payroll Administrator I team members, serving as a point of escalation for more complex payroll issues and questions. β’ Identify opportunities for payroll process improvements and lead or support implementation of enhanced procedures, tools, and controls. β’ Works effectively with others in a team environment to accomplish organizational goals and to identify and resolve problems. β’ Exhibits and adheres to the established Visual Comfort Company Values. β’ Must demonstrate commitment, dependability, punctuality, and adherence to agreed-upon schedule while maintaining a consistent presence in the workplace to effectively collaborate and communicate amongst co-workers and teams.
β’ Associate's degree in Business, Human Resources,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and relevant work experience. β’ 2-4 years of experience processing multi-state payroll in a fast-paced environment. β’ Extensive knowledge of payroll administration, including payroll processing, balancing, internal controls, payroll taxes, and compliance with applicable federal, state, and local regulations. β’ Working knowledge of accounting principles and practices. β’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, including intermediate-level Excel skills; experience with HRIS systems required, with Dayforce experience preferred. β’ Experience generating and analyzing reports; familiarity with Power BI or similar reporting tools preferred. β’ Strong analytical, problem-solving, and critical-thinking skills with the ability to identify issues and implement effective solutions. β’ Exceptional attention to detail, organizational skills, and time management abilities, with the capacity to manage multiple priorities and meet tight deadlines. β’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ment, fostering cooperation and achieving results through strong working relationships. β’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to effectively interact through multiple channels, including email, phone, and chat, while maintaining professionalism and discretion when handling sensitive and confidential information. β’ Flexibility to work varying schedules, including weekends, early mornings, and late evenings, as business needs require. β’ Demonstrated ability to work independently and exercise sound judgment in resolving complex payroll matters with minimal supervision.
β’ Work-Life Balance: Monday β Friday, 8:30am β 5:00pm β’ Training & Development: A comprehensive and structured training program, complemented by ongoing education and opportunities for career advancement. β’ Paid Time Off: Generous vacation accrual and paid time off policies. β’ Holidays: 7 paid holidays per year, in addition to 2 floating holidays. β’ Compensation: Competitive compensation plan β’ Health Benefits: Visual Comfort covers the majority of employee medical premiums, and offers competitive vision and dental coverage available starting the first of the month following your start date. β’ Insurance: Company-provided life insurance and short-term disability coverage. β’ Retirement: 401(k) plan with company matching up to 4%, available beginning the first of the month following your hire date.
